What is Freebase Nicotine?
Freebase nicotine is the purest form of nicotine used in e-liquids. It has been the standard in vaping since the beginning. The term “freebase” comes from the cocaine industry and refers to the unbound, purest form of the compound.
Characteristics of Freebase Nicotine:
- Higher pH level (more alkaline)
- Produces a stronger throat hit
- Typically used in traditional vaping setups
- Available in various nicotine strengths (0mg to 18mg+)
- Slower nicotine absorption rate
What are Nicotine Salts?
Nicotine salts are created by combining nicotine with an acid (usually benzoic acid) to create a more stable molecule. This technology was developed to mimic the natural nicotine found in tobacco leaves more closely.
Characteristics of Nicotine Salts:
- Lower pH level (less alkaline)
- Smoother throat hit even at higher nicotine levels
- Designed for pod systems and low-power devices
- Available in higher nicotine concentrations (20mg to 50mg+)
- Faster nicotine absorption rate
Key Differences at a Glance
Smoothness
Freebase nicotine can be harsh at high strengths, while nicotine salts provide a smooth experience even at high nicotine levels.
Throat Hit
Freebase offers a strong throat hit, whereas nicotine salts are milder on the throat.
Best Devices
Freebase nicotine works best with mods and sub-ohm tanks. Nicotine salts are ideal for pod systems and MTL devices.
Cloud Production
Freebase nicotine produces larger clouds. Nicotine salts produce smaller, more discreet vapour.

Nicotine Strength Guide
Freebase Nicotine Levels:
- 0mg: No nicotine (flavour only)
- 3mg: Very low (cloud chasers)
- 6mg: Low (light smokers)
- 12mg: Medium (moderate smokers)
- 18mg: High (heavy smokers)
Nicotine Salt Levels:
- 10-20mg: Low to medium
- 25-35mg: Medium to high
- 40-50mg: High (very strong)

The Benzoic Acid Factor
Nicotine salts typically use benzoic acid to achieve their smooth profile. This additive:
- Creates a more stable nicotine molecule
- Allows for higher nicotine concentrations without harshness
- Improves nicotine absorption efficiency
- Is considered safe in the concentrations used
Common Myths Debunked
Myth 1: Nicotine Salts Are More Dangerous
Fact: Both types contain nicotine, which is addictive. The health risks are similar. The difference is in the delivery method and user experience, not toxicity.
Myth 2: Freebase Is Always Harsh
Fact: Modern freebase e-liquids can be quite smooth, especially at lower nicotine levels. Device settings also greatly affect the experience.
Myth 3: Nicotine Salts Get You More Hooked
Fact: Addiction depends on nicotine intake, not the form. Users choose based on preference and device compatibility.
